At 11:31 AM -0400 8/18/04, Robert Watson wrote:
>A first test for any open source replacement for CVS in the
>FreeBSD project is that it be able to import our current
>history and workload efficiently.   I believe last time this
>was attempted with Subversion, the importer ran at least a
>month before the person trying it gave up :-).

That was with an earlier version of the conversion script.  I
am told by one of the subversion guys that the script has been
considerably improved since then, but I haven't had the time
to try it out.
